Ooooh. That’s an interesting twist. I hadn’t even considered the possibility that there would be people intentionally driving their number up to stay on the train longer. Fair enough, I guess! If you think it’s better than your life back home, go for it. But. But, but, but…she’s dragging other people into it, encouraging them to drive up their number, and being a shithead to the denizens. She’s not Amelia by any means, obviously, but she’s going to be an interesting villain in her own right.
But she’s going to be a complex one, for sure. She seems like she’s not going to take no for an answer from Jesse, and may actually manage to drive up his number a little. Hopefully the lessons he’s learned about being a bully stick with him.
This is going to be interesting.
The Lucky Cat Car was REALLY fun, and has introduced an interesting new villain besides. It comes in at my new #1 for season 2, above The Black Market Car, and my new #5 overall, between The Ball Pit Car and The Cat’s Car.
